a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/main/scala/xyz.driver.sbt/Service.scala5
1 files changed, 3 insertions, 2 deletions
diff --git a/src/main/scala/xyz.driver.sbt/Service.scala b/src/main/scala/xyz.driver.sbt/Service.scala
index be05f1b..b35d215 100644
--- a/src/main/scala/xyz.driver.sbt/Service.scala
+++ b/src/main/scala/xyz.driver.sbt/Service.scala
@@ -47,9 +47,10 @@ object Service extends AutoPlugin {
s"""|if [[ -f /etc/${name.value}/ssl/issuing_ca ]]; then
| keytool -import \
| -alias driverincInternal \
- | -keystore $$JAVA_HOME/jre/lib/security/cacerts \
+ | -cacerts \
| -file /etc/${name.value}/ssl/issuing_ca \
- | -storepass changeit -noprompt
+ | -storepass changeit -noprompt \
+ | || exit 1
|else
| echo "No truststore customization." >&2
|fi